Sizing, grading and inclusive fit for US backless shaper ranges
The conclusion for American designer labels is clear: inclusive sizing is not optional in backless shaper programs. US consumers expect extended size ranges that maintain consistent shaping performance from XS through plus sizes. Poor grading is one of the main causes of discomfort, rolling edges, and negative reviews in backless shapewear.
Effective grading requires more than scaling measurements. Compression zones, bonding angles, and backless geometry must be re-engineered per size group. For custom backless shaper solutions for American designer dress labels, this means pattern precision at a technical level, supported by real wear testing rather than static measurements.

Design options for plunge necklines and low-back shaper bodysuits
The conclusion in this category is that design flexibility determines how widely backless shapers can be used across collections. American designers increasingly demand modular solutions that adapt to deep V necklines, halter fronts, and ultra-low backs without compromising hold or aesthetics.
Low-back shaper bodysuits may incorporate adhesive zones, reinforced side panels, or engineered tension lines that redirect support away from the spine. Plunge fronts require careful bust shaping that supports without visible structure. These design options are best developed through OEM/ODM collaboration, where structure and fabric choices are tested together.

Reducing dress returns with integrated backless shaper solutions
The conclusion here is straightforward: many dress returns are fit-related, not design-related. Backless dresses amplify this issue because consumers lack appropriate undergarments at home.
By integrating custom backless shaper solutions for American designer dress labels into the purchase journey—whether through recommendations, bundles, or styling guidance—brands proactively solve a common pain point. This reduces return rates, protects margins, and improves customer satisfaction.
